> A consequence of this is that the original keyfob gets out of sync, and will no longer function.

I always wonder about this: what is the consequence of that? Can the user reset it, or does it have to be done by a retailer or something?

Depends on the implementation. Most times you just have to click it a few times in a row. The receiver then realizes it missed a few button presses and it re-syncs. I’m not sure what that window is though, at some point it might get so out of sync that the receiver ignores it and assumes it is a wrong fob.

If I remember correctly the size of the rolling window differs, more modern vehicles may allow about 100 code discrepancy before ignoring the transmitter, while old models might have been 5 to 10.
